Call of Duty: Black Ops 4 Announced
Releasing this October
News by Grayshadow on Mar 08, 2018
After so many rumors and leaks it's official, Call of Duty: Black Ops 4 is releasing this October.
The game has been confirmed to be in development by Treyarch, the studio behind the Black Ops series. A full reveal coming May 17th as the current trailer only shows past entries of the game. However, the flashing images not only showcase drones and characters from the franchise but zombies. It's likely the zombies' mode will be part of the game.
It's worth mentioning that a Switch version has been rumored but not confirmed. Considering the system sold millions of units before its 1-year anniversary it's likely Activision will want to ensure their next Call of Duty game is available to all those gamers.
Call of Duty: Black Ops 4 launches this October 12th.
